About Zhijun Li

Zhijun Li is a scholar working on Geophysics, Artificial Intelligence, Ocean Engineering, Environmental Engineering and Civil and Structural Engineering, having authored 35 papers that have together received 543 indexed citations. Recurring topics across this work include Geological and Geochemical Analysis (15 papers), Geochemistry and Geologic Mapping (11 papers), Drilling and Well Engineering (9 papers), earthquake and tectonic studies (8 papers), Microbial Applications in Construction Materials (6 papers), Hydrocarbon exploration and reservoir analysis (4 papers), High-pressure geophysics and materials (4 papers) and Grouting, Rheology, and Soil Mechanics (4 papers). The work is most often cited by research in Geophysics (411 citations), Artificial Intelligence (258 citations), Geochemistry and Petrology (35 citations), Ocean Engineering (56 citations) and Geology (20 citations). Zhijun Li has collaborated with scholars based in China, United States and Netherlands. Frequent co-authors include Juxing Tang, Yong Huang, Xinghai Lang, Fuwei Xie, Feng Ding, Qin Wang, Huanhuan Yang, Li Zhang, Yun Zhou and J. K. Hourigan. Their work appears in journals such as ACS Omega, Journal of Asian Earth Sciences, International Geology Review, Journal of Petroleum Science and Engineering and Ore Geology Reviews.
